Compare Bethesda to North Bethesda

This post compares Bethesda, Maryland to North Bethesda, Maryland across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Bethesda (CDP) North Bethesda (CDP)
Population 63,168 50,056
Income (median) $110,889 $78,644
Home Value (median) $877,300 $550,900
White 80% 68%
Black 3% 7%
Asian 11% 14%
With Kids 30% 26%
Age (median) 43 39
Rentals 32% 47%

Questions and Answers:

Q: Which is more populated, Bethesda or North Bethesda?
A: Bethesda has a larger population count than North Bethesda: 63168 compared with 50056 total people.

Q: Do incomes tend to be higher in Bethesda or in North Bethesda?
A: Incomes are on average much higher in Bethesda.

Q: Are homes more expensive in Bethesda or North Bethesda?
A: Homes tend to be more expensive in Bethesda.

Q: Which has a higher percentage of housing rental units?
A: North Bethesda does. The percentage of rentals differs quite a bit: 32% for Bethesda versus 47% for North Bethesda.
